The Becker boys and girls cross country teams held their awards night with a pot luck dinner this week.
The girls team was awarded the Minnesota High School Coaches Association Gold academic award and the boys team was awarded the Silver academic award.
Academic all-state went to Alli Hendrickson.
Plaques were given to the most valuable runners. For the girls it was Hendrickson and for the boys it was Luke Pappenfus.
For most improved, Victoria Kolbinger and Karly Kowalsky won iy for the girls while Jake Nelson won it on the boys side.
Hendrickson won most dedicated for the girls and Pappenfus for the boys.
Adeline Kent won rookie award for the girls and Justin Kringler for boys.
The team’s Bulldog award went to Lexi Dehmer (girls) and Wyatt Hiltner (boys).
The G.O.A.T. award was handed out to Basil Ricker.
Named to all-conference were Hendrickson, Kolbinger, Dehmer, Kent and Gabrielle Imm for the girls and Pappenfus and Ricker for the boys.
Honorable mention went to Maddie McDonald (girls) and Jonathan Novak (boys).
Letterwinners were Abby Fingarson, Belinda Edling, Dehmer, Callie Doucette, McDonald, Kent, Grace Smith, Tate Spinner, Alyssa Thielen, Kolbinger, Imm, Alllyna Storms, Hendrickson and Sydney Stommes for the girls and Even Schafer, Jake Nelson, Kringler, David Myres, Ricker, Novak, Pappenfus, Bennett Edling and Christian Riffe for the boys.
Captains were chosen for next season and for the boys it was Pappenfus, Novak and Kringler and for the girls it is Hendrickson, Kayden Westin and Jessica Sand.
Sioux Falls Meet
Several Becker runners participated in the Nike Heartland Regional Cross Country race last Saturday in Sioux Falls, SD.
Teams participating came from Minnesota, North Dakota, South Dakota, Iowa, Nebraska, Wisconsin and Kansas.
Pappenfus, Novak, Kringler, Myres, Ricker, Jake Nelson, Bennett Edling, Hendrickson, Kolbinger, Stommes, Imm and McDonald were the runners representing Becker and Minnesota.
